[Some anthropologists and psychologists suggest that the ADD/ADHD arrangement of the prefrontal cortex may have been an evolutionary advantage 20,000 years ago when humans had a greater need to respond rapidly to stimuli in the environment and to consider creative or non-linear approaches to solving problems.]
